How 95828 schools perform

The top-ranked school is Camellia Elementary with a Scope Score of 61 and 31.9% of students exceeding standard.

Average proficiency falls 7.3 percentage points from grade 3 to grade 5 across 95828. This pattern in test scores may reflect a variety of factors and is worth examining school by school.

Chronic absenteeism across 95828 averages 29.7%, above the state average of 17.9%. CDE CAASPP 2025.

What Scope Scores can't tell you about 95828

Numbers tell you whether students are clearing the bar. A school visit tells you whether they're happy doing it. These metrics are intentionally missing from the Scope Score: class sizes and student-teacher interaction quality; arts, music, athletics, and enrichment programs; teacher experience and turnover; campus safety and social-emotional support; parent and community engagement; quality of special education and gifted programs; how school zones and enrollment boundaries affect access. How many schools are in zip code 95828?
Zip code 95828 has 9 ranked schools with Scope Scores. Schools are ranked using a weighted composite of CAASPP test performance, growth trajectory, chronic absenteeism, and suspension rate. Schools with insufficient testing data are not ranked.
What does the Scope Score measure?
The Scope Score is SchoolScope's proprietary composite rating (0–100) based on seven dimensions of publicly available California school data: the exceeded-vs-met standard split, overall proficiency, grade 3–5 growth, chronic absenteeism, suspension rate, ELPAC English Learner proficiency, and baseline proficiency.
